Transaction 07c710f50776a8b60cb6ff009cebe79f48cd96a56448edabdc08315cc72226ff

1 Input
1 Outputs
  • 07c710f50776a8b60cb6ff009cebe79f48cd96a56448edabdc08315cc72226ff:0
  • value  33878
    address  3PF4fDeM8nDBtieJHuGhgQrkTmvJ3b195X